Sending Your Kid to an Infant Care?
If you are planning to send your child to a center providing infant care, you have to prepare your kid before doing so. Explain to your child what to expect from the center. Take the child with you when you visit the center.

Tummy Time for Infants
Tummy time helps infants develop strong neck and shoulder muscles, as well as promote motor skills. We at Creative Kidz always have tummy time sessions for the little toddlers enrolled with us.

Minimizing Screen-Time Before Bed
Lesser screen-time an hour before bed will help your child sleep better. Blue light from screens prevents your child’s body from effectively producing sleep hormones. So make bedtimes easier by hiding those gadgets!
